found some info

>How far into the engine are you planning to go with this first car? I have been curious if the stock red line is more to do with skyactiv engines being tuned for power in the midrange or if there are mechanical limits near 7000rpm. Mazda says the crankshaft is really light and the stroke is longer than most 2 liter engines.

>We have one apart now. Crank is fine, forged. Rods are teeny. Carrillo is making a custom set for us that will be lighter than OEM and stronger. OEM pistons. The motor is pretty much blueprinted straight from the factory. Motorcycle type tolerances everywhere. Worlds away from a BP. Micro polish the crank, port the oil pump, valve springs and a few other tweaks. Found some stuff in the ports we can fix. basic shape is good though. Mostly just making it tolerate 7500rpm.

>Depending on which type of dyno, stock is 140-142whp. The SAG 2.0L is highly responsive to ECU tuning andreallylikes the corn (e85). 100% stock with reflash on 91-93 octane is seeing 20whp bump so, ~160whp. I'm pretty sure we'll see 200whp with corn and built engine. Couple that with 1.4g on street tires. Yeah, might be fun to drive.

>>14111156
don't forget that most of the good modern jap cars were inspired at least initially by the desire to move into the North American market.

There would be no GTR if there was no north american Datsun 510.
The 70's turbo Z cars were intially North America only because japan wouldn't permit turbocharging on a "large displacement" 2.4 I6.
The celica was basically japan making a pony car.

And most of the american sports cars were based on a domestic application of European concepts.
Corvette was designed with the Jag coupes in mind, the Mustang was a rebodied falcon.

Neither were any good until they put a V8 in them and thats sort of where america really started to realize their own identity in sports cars.
